ABOUT PINOT NOIR
Brought to you by Wine Folly
 
Pinot Noir is the world’s most popular light-bodied red wine. It’s loved for its red fruit, flower, and spice aromas that are accentuated by a long, smooth finish. Likely originating in Burgundy, France–today, there are almost 244,000 acres of Pinot Noir planted across the world with France, the United States, and Germany leading in total acreage.
